Log in using your account   

Get directions to: Carrabba''s Italian Grill, Bensalem, PA

Restaurant address: 3210 Tillman Dr Bensalem, PA 19020, USA

Restaurant: Carrabba''s Italian Grill

Live Help Every Restaurant in the City